Il daemon di trasmissione continua a reimpostarsi


14

ho provato a configurare il daemon di trasmissione in modo da poter connettermi utilizzando il webui disponibile su http: //server.ip-address: 9091 , ma ricevo solo un messaggio che mi dice che dovrei disabilitare la whitelist dell'indirizzo IP o aggiungere il mio ip corrente ad esso.

Ho modificato il file disponibile in /etc/transmission-daemon/settings.json e ho modificato il parametro rpc-whitelist-enabled su false, salvare il file e riavviare il servizio con: sudo service transmission-daemon restart. Dopo di che ricontrollo le settings.json ho appena modificato solo per scoprire che tutte le mie modifiche sono state annullate. Cosa sta succedendo qui? Qualcun altro ha già visto questo comportamento prima?


1
Okay ... ho appena scoperto cosa stava succedendo, se modifichi il file settings.json devi riavviare il servizio con: sudo invoke-rc.d transmission-daemon reload
AcidRod75

4
Il demone di trasmissione riavvia il file di configurazione all'uscita. Per modificarlo senza sovrascrivere devi sudo service transmission-daemon stopprima di modificarlo.
con-f-use

@ con-f-use Inserisci il tuo commento come risposta. Merita di essere accettato come la risposta corretta.
Zoot

Risposte:


25

Il daemon di trasmissione riscrive il file di configurazione con le vecchie opzioni quando esce. Per rendere persistenti le modifiche, è necessario modificare il file di configurazione senza l'esecuzione di Deamon. Quindi prima:

sudo stop transmission-daemon

O se non è stato installato tramite Software Center / Repository ufficiali:

sudo killall -HUP transmission-da

Successivamente è possibile modificare settings.jsoncome previsto e quindi riavviare la trasmissione:

sudo start transmission-daemon 

1

Modifica /var/lib/transmission-daemon/.config/transmission-daemon/settings.jsonquale file sembra essere copiato dopo ogni riavvio systemddell'unità transmission-daemon.service. Non ho trovato un riferimento, ma conferma un semplice test.


la modifica di entrambi non ha risolto il mio problema. anche quando il servizio era stato interrotto.
user3836415
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.